Different Welder’s Certifications
Although the AWS’ basic CW (Certified Welder) certification helps make you eligible for most employment opportunities, certain industries demand their own certain certification. A handful of the most-well-known of which are highlighted below.
- ASME Certification for individuals who handle boiler and pressurized vessels
- Certified Welder Certification to be a Certified Welder
- American Petroleum Institute Certification for welders who work on pipelines in the gas and oil field
- Certified Welding Instructor and Senior Certified Welding Instructor Certification for Welding Inspectors and Senior Welding Inspectors

The below graphic shows job and wage forecasts for professional welders in Florida through 2022.
| Florida | Employment | |||
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2012 | 2022 | Change | Annual Job Openings | |
|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ers | 11,720 | 14,620 | 25% | 600 |
| Florida | Annual Salary | ||
|---|---|---|---|
| Low | Median | High | |
|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ers |
$23,600 | $35,100 | $53,800 |
Source: O*Net Online

Among the first factors you will want to look into is whether the class happens to be accredited by the AWS. When you finish checking the accreditation status, you need to search a little bit further to make sure that the school you want can provide you with the proper training.
- Make sure the program teaches with equipment that fits up-to-date trade guidelines
- Find out if the school offers financial aid
- Make sure that the school’s curriculum provides classes in GTAW, SMAW, pipe welding and GMAW
- Find classes that satisfy AWS SENSE standards
